Breaking New Ground: The Return of an Arcade Icon

For fans of classic arcade action, Arkanoid Plus! (USA) (WiiWare) (DLC) represents a fascinating chapter in the long history of one of gaming’s most influential franchises. Released through Nintendo's WiiWare service and developed by Taito, this downloadable expansion built upon the foundation of Arkanoid Plus!, delivering additional stages and fresh challenges for players who simply could not get enough brick-breaking action.

While the original Arkanoid became a global sensation in arcades during the mid-1980s, the WiiWare era provided Taito with an opportunity to reintroduce the series to a modern audience. The DLC release expanded the experience significantly, demonstrating how digital distribution could extend a game's lifespan long before season passes and live-service updates became common industry practices.

At a time when many WiiWare releases experimented with unique concepts and smaller-scale experiences, Arkanoid Plus! stood out by proving that timeless gameplay mechanics could remain just as addictive decades after their debut.

Arkanoid Plus! (USA) (WiiWare) (DLC): Expanding the Formula

The brilliance of Arkanoid has always been rooted in simplicity. Players control the Vaus paddle at the bottom of the screen, bouncing an energy ball toward formations of blocks above. Destroy every breakable block, survive the increasingly difficult layouts, and advance to the next stage.

The DLC content expanded this formula with additional stages that challenged even experienced Arkanoid veterans. These new levels featured denser block arrangements, more complex obstacle placement, and greater reliance on precision shots. Rather than merely increasing difficulty through faster ball speeds, Taito designed levels that encouraged strategic thinking and mastery of ball angles.

Every bounce matters. Skilled players learn to manipulate rebound trajectories, intentionally striking the edge of the paddle to direct the ball toward hard-to-reach targets. This mechanical depth remains one of the defining reasons Arkanoid continues to captivate players decades after its creation.

Power-Ups That Transform Every Match

Power capsules remain central to the Arkanoid experience. Destroying specific blocks causes special items to descend toward the paddle, granting temporary advantages that can dramatically alter the flow of a level.

  • Laser Cannons allow direct attacks against stubborn block formations.
  • Expand increases paddle width, making ball control easier.
  • Multi-Ball introduces chaos and massive scoring opportunities.
  • Catch lets players temporarily hold the ball before relaunching it.
  • Slow reduces ball speed during demanding sections.

These upgrades add an element of unpredictability and strategic decision-making. Sometimes chasing a falling capsule introduces more risk than reward, forcing players to make split-second choices under pressure.

Mastering the Maze: Level Design and Challenge

The DLC stages showcase some of the most inventive level construction seen in the WiiWare version. Indestructible blocks create narrow corridors, forcing players to exploit precise rebound angles. Enemy ships periodically enter the playfield, disrupting established patterns and demanding quick reactions.

Many stages function almost like puzzles. Success often requires identifying weak points within a formation and carving efficient routes through complex brick arrangements. The challenge is demanding without feeling unfair, striking a balance that arcade enthusiasts appreciate.

This design philosophy encourages repeated playthroughs. Every failure teaches a lesson, while every successful run reveals new opportunities for optimization and higher scores.

Technical Polish on Nintendo Wii

Despite WiiWare's relatively strict file-size limitations, Arkanoid Plus! delivers a remarkably polished presentation. The game's visuals maintain the clean, readable aesthetic that made the arcade original so effective while introducing modern graphical flourishes.

Particle effects accompany block destruction, colorful backgrounds add visual variety, and animations remain smooth even during intense multi-ball situations. Most importantly, the game maintains responsive controls and low input lag, essential characteristics for a precision-based arcade experience.

The Wii Remote implementation feels surprisingly natural. Whether using traditional button controls or motion-based input options, players can achieve the precision required for advanced gameplay techniques.

The soundtrack complements the action with energetic electronic themes while preserving the arcade spirit that long-time fans expect from the franchise.

The Lasting Legacy of Arkanoid

Few arcade franchises have maintained relevance as effectively as Arkanoid. The series helped define the brick-breaker genre and inspired countless successors across home computers, consoles, mobile devices, and indie platforms.

Arkanoid Plus! and its DLC content represent an important preservation milestone because they capture a unique moment in Nintendo's digital distribution history. These releases demonstrated how downloadable content could meaningfully extend a game's longevity without compromising its core design.

Today, retro gaming communities continue to organize score competitions and challenge runs, while speedrunners search for optimal routes through increasingly difficult stages. The game's emphasis on precision, consistency, and mastery ensures its continued appeal among dedicated arcade enthusiasts.

For collectors and preservationists, Arkanoid Plus! remains one of the standout examples of how a classic arcade formula can be successfully adapted for the digital era.
